SUMMARY
Ordinance 2022-04 would amend Section 20-323 of the City Code to amend
the list of permitted uses in the Town Center District Code. The ordinance
would change veterinary clinics from a conditional to a permitted use in the
T4 and T5 Transects, provided that no overnight boarding or outdoor kennels
shall be allowed except for indoor overnight boarding necessary for post-
operation medical observation. Staff recommends approval of this change as
being consistent with already-permitted uses in the T4 and T5 Transects,
particularly including pet shops and grooming uses. In addition, the
already-permitted use of"medical clinics and laboratories" would be
amended to clarify that dental clinics are also permitted.
